Skip to content

Senior Full Stack Software Engineer - React, Node.js

Chicago, Boston, Massachusetts (USA)

Role Overview

If you get excited about building products from conception to production and helping clients achieve their goals, then this is the role for you! 
We are looking for an experienced Full Stack Engineer to join our team. In this role, you will work with a high-functioning team of engineers to modernize our client’s platforms using languages and technologies such as React, Node.js, GraphQL and AWS at an enterprise level. Apart from solution delivery, you will have the opportunity to leverage your leadership and mentoring skills by helping to support and develop the more junior engineers on the team.

This is a remote full-time opportunity in Canada or in the U.S. There will be travel requirements 1 week per quarter (every 3 months) to the client site in the U.S.


  • Work with peers to analyze technical system problems/defects, and design and implement effective solutions.
  • Handle end-to-end development, including development, testing, and deployment.
  • Work with Scrum Masters, Product Owners, business stakeholders, and peers to iteratively create software that meets business and technical requirements.
  • Contribute to the development of team backlog, plans, and assignments.  
  • Develop comprehensive automated tests for multiple scopes (Unit, System, Integration, Regression).
  • Offer mentorship by asking clarifying questions and giving constructive feedback through pull requests and team discussions while taking feedback gracefully.
  • Be part of a culture of innovation and learning.
  • Create and maintain technical documentation. 

Required Skills

  • High proficiency with Javascript (es6).
  • Proficient in developing applications using modern React framework.
  • Strong experience with GraphQL.
  • Strong experience using Node.js and Express/Koa.
  • A sound foundation in Javascript testing frameworks (e.g. Jest, Cypress).
  • Experience working with distributed and cross-functional agile teams.
  • Experience working with CI/CD Pipelines (GitHub, Jenkins, Bitbucket, Bamboo etc.).
  • Strong verbal and written communication skills.

Additional Assets

  • Experience with AWS (Lambda, S3, API Gateway)
  • Experience working with micro-frontend architecture
  • Experience with TypeScript

If you would like to work in a creative, collaborate, high-growth environment, this is the perfect opportunity for you! Please submit your resume and be sure to tell us why you think you’d be a great fit! We look forward to hearing from you!

The position is in English, bilingual in French is an asset


Levio offers many benefits in order to provide the greatest possible flexibility to its employees! In addition to offering a stimulating and dynamic work environment, we offer:

  • Group insurance
  • A pension fund
  • A professional development allowance of $2500
  • Public transportation or parking is paid
  • Referral bonuses
  • An active social club

Job status: Full time, 37.5 hours/week

  • Levio is an equal opportunity employer and has an equal employment opportunity program for women, Aboriginal people, visible minorities, ethnic minorities and persons with disabilities. The masculine gender is used without discrimination and for the sole purpose of lightening this text.